Lessons went global for one Wallington primary school last week when the spotlight fell on the rest of the world.

Cooking classes took on an international flavour as the Banstead branch of Waitrose dished up Caribbean fare, like banana celeste and ginger cake. And close to 300 youngsters from Beddington Infants stepped to the rhythm during a display by the Trishul Dance Company, who brought their moves all the way from India.

Corinne Green, dressed in a kimono, hailed the week a resounding success.
